Arbor Appoints Ben Truitt as Director of FHA in Denver Office

by Jeff Shaw

DENVER — Arbor Commercial Mortgage LLC, a New York-based commercial real estate lender, has appointed Ben Truitt as director of FHA in the company’s Denver office.

A 17-year commercial real estate finance veteran, Truitt will be responsible for providing capital for the refinance, acquisition and construction of multifamily and seniors housing through Federal Housing Administration, Fannie Mae, Freddie Mac and creative structured finance loans, including bridge, mezzanine and preferred equity funding options.

Prior to joining Arbor, Truitt began his commercial lending career as an originator with GMAC Commercial Mortgage. Since then, through various roles with GMAC, PNC Bank, Red Stone, AmeriSphere and ACRE, his healthcare and multifamily financing expertise includes a U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) Multifamily Accelerated Processing (MAP) designation. In his career, Truitt has been involved with the origination or underwriting of $570 million in closed loans.

Truitt is a member of the Urban Land Institute, University of Colorado Real Estate Council (CUREC), Colorado Health Care Association & Center for Assisted Living and the CFA Institute. He serves on the Education Committee for the CUREC and is also the Public Awareness Committee chair for the CFA Society of Colorado.

Truitt received his Master of Business Administration degree in real estate development and investments from the University of Colorado-Boulder, where he also received an undergraduate degree in mechanical engineering.
